Absence of EAE-induced nonevoked ongoing pain in CaMKIIαT286A point mutant mice. A, Lidocaine produced CPP in wild-type mice with EAE, but CaMKIIαT286A point mutant mice with EAE showed no chamber preference, compared with saline-treated wild-type mice. ***p < 0.001 compared with saline paired chamber. B, Difference scores (test time − preconditioning time in each chamber) confirmed that wild-type mice with EAE, but not CaMKIIαT286A point mutant mice with EAE, exhibited CPP to lidocaine. *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01 test time compared with preconditioning time. Data are expressed as the mean ± SEM.
